Sir Menalik aka Cyclops 4000 aka Scaramanga aka Jabbar El aka Chewbacca Uncircumcised first made a name for himself reading out technical manuals on Dr. Octagon, but it was his Scaramanga material that really made an impression on CRC-minded rap fans as he delivered wordy jiggnorance over outstanding beats. Both versions of ‘Mind I.C. Mine’ are worthy of legendary status alone, as were his contributions to the field of Intellectual Noise Rap on the outstanding Cobra Commander CD. Here are sixteen of my favorite Menalik moments for you to zone out to. Here’s the interview that former Unkut contributor Keir Johnson did with him way back in 2005 to set the scene…
